What is a Betting Wheel and Its Appeal for Homeowners
A betting wheel, also known as a money wheel or big six wheel, is a large, vertical wheel divided into segments, each marked with numbers, symbols, or monetary values. Players place bets on where the wheel will stop, making it a game of chance that’s easy to learn and endlessly engaging. For homeowners, incorporating a betting wheel into a game room or entertainment space can elevate social gatherings, providing a casino-like atmosphere without leaving home.
The appeal lies in its simplicity and versatility. Unlike complex card games, a betting wheel requires minimal setup and can accommodate groups of all sizes. It’s perfect for family game nights (with non-monetary stakes) or adult parties where friendly wagers add excitement. History and Evolution of the Betting Wheel
The betting wheel traces its roots back to ancient carnival games and evolved into a staple in casinos during the 19th century. Originally used in fairs for simple bets, it gained popularity in Las Vegas as the Big Six wheel, featuring sections with dollar amounts. Today, modern versions include digital adaptations, but the classic spinning wheel remains a favorite.

How to Set Up a Betting Wheel in Your Home
Setting up a betting wheel at home is straightforward, but thoughtful planning ensures safety and enjoyment. Start by selecting the right size—tabletop versions are ideal for smaller spaces, while full-sized wheels (up to 6 feet in diameter) suit dedicated game rooms. Ensure the wheel is mounted securely on a stable base to prevent accidents.
Next, think about lighting and surroundings. Ambient lighting can enhance the casino feel, and comfortable seating around the wheel encourages longer play sessions. For those remodeling, incorporating built-in storage for betting chips or accessories can keep things organized. Practical advice: Always use soft, non-slip flooring beneath the setup to avoid slips, especially in high-traffic areas.
Choosing the Right Betting Wheel for Your Space
When selecting a betting wheel, consider factors like material, size, and customization. Wooden wheels offer a classic look, while plastic or metal ones are more durable for frequent use. Homeowners should prioritize wheels with smooth spinning mechanisms to ensure fair play.
Here’s a comparison of popular betting wheel types:
| Type | Size | Material | Best For | Price Range |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Tabletop | 1-2 feet | Plastic | Small gatherings | $50-$150 |
| Standard | 3-4 feet | Wood | Family rooms | $200-$500 |
| Professional | 5-6 feet | Metal/Wood | Dedicated game rooms | $600+ |
| Digital | Variable | Electronic | Tech-savvy homes | $300-$1000 |
This table highlights options to match your home’s needs and budget. Expert insight: Opt for wheels with adjustable segments to customize bets, adding replay value.
